Nutrition & ingredients

Ingredients

serves 6
  • 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 pound Italian sausage ( (casings removed, if using links))
  • 1 small sweet onion (, diced)
  • 3 cloves garlic (, minced)
  • 1/4 teaspoon dried Italian seasoning
  • 1/8 to 1/4 teaspoon coarse sal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1/8 teaspoon cracked red pepper flakes ((optional))
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ste
  • 3 1/2 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 1 cup marinara sauce
  • 12 ounces uncooked rigatoni pasta ((about 3/4 of a box))
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 6 basil leaves (, sliced)
